Best Chikmagalur Trekking Places


The region around Chikmagalur is filled with numerous trekking trails that cater to every level of difficulty. Among the most renowned Chikmagalur trekking places is Mullayangiri Hills, the topmost elevation in Karnataka, standing tall at about nearly two kilometres above sea level. The trek to Mullayanagiri is both exhilarating and rewarding, offering stunning views of the Western Ghats. The trail passes along shady groves, lush paths, and stony tracks, making it a top choice among adventure enthusiasts.

Another must-visit trekking destination is Budangiri Range, a mystical peak known for its spiritual and heritage significance. The trek from Mullayanagiri to Baba Budangiri is one of the most memorable routes, featuring cloud-wrapped routes, clear springs, and scenic landscapes. Kemmanagundi Peak, another well-known destination, offers a pleasant climb combined with incredible scenery of waterfalls like Kalhatti and Hebbe Falls. Kuduremukha, often known as the “Horse-Faced Peak,” is yet another gem in the Chikmagalur region. The Kudremukh trek is a exhilarating experience for nature lovers, as it passes through streams, open plains, and mountain forests teeming with plants and animals.

Best Time for Trekking in Chikmagalur


The best time to enjoy Chikmagalur trekking is between the cooler months, when the weather remains cool and pleasant. The monsoon months, from June to August, transform the region into a lush paradise with fog-laden summits and roaring streams, although the trails can be muddy. For those seeking adventure, post-monsoon treks provide the most fresh greenery and balanced climate for long hikes. During winter, the skies are bright, offering far-reaching sights from the summits and great nights for outdoor stays.

Essential Tips for Trekkers


Before embarking on trekking at Chikmagalur, it’s essential to be ready and organised. Wearing supportive hiking boots, carrying enough fluids, energy foods, and medical essentials are musts. As the terrain often involves steep climbs and forest trails, comfortable gear and a good backpack are recommended. Trekkers should also avoid leaving waste and respect the natural surroundings to preserve Chikmagalur’s untouched charm. Hiring a professional trek leader is advisable, especially for lesser-known trails, as they are well-versed with the area’s geography and ecology.

For those taking part in extended hikes, physical training in advance can make the experience more enjoyable. Since many trails involve walking uphill for hours, regular fitness routines can help improve stamina. It’s also wise to check climate updates before planning the trek and carry a poncho if travelling during the monsoon.
